Water-based protection readiness
Firefighting systems depend on many connected components: pumps, controllers, water supplies, valves, pipework, sprinklers, hose reels, hydrants and portable extinguishers. A visible installation is not the same as a maintained and operationally ready system.
Secure State provides firefighting system maintenance and AMC support across Dubai. Scheduled inspections and functional checks are coordinated with the building, the installed system and the agreed maintenance scope, with attention to safe access and operational continuity.
Our reporting separates completed work from active defects and recommended rectification. This gives owners, facility teams and responsible stakeholders a clearer basis for approving corrective action and maintaining system readiness.
Specialist capability
Planned maintenance and accountable reporting across the components that store, move and apply firefighting water—and the portable equipment supporting first response.
Inspection, operational checks and preventive maintenance for accessible fire pumps, controllers, associated valves and supporting components.
Inspection and maintenance of accessible sprinkler pipework, valves, alarm-valve arrangements, flow devices and visible system condition.
Checks covering accessible hose reels, landing valves, hydrants, cabinets, hoses, nozzles, valves and related water-supply condition.
Scheduled inspection and maintenance of portable extinguishers, including condition, location, accessibility, identification and service status.
Visual condition review of accessible fire-water tanks, isolation and control valves, gauges, pipework supports and signs of leakage or deterioration.
Maintenance records, identified defects, technical recommendations and controlled corrective work to support continued system readiness.
